dc.description.abstract Dr. James P. Ronda, professor of history in Youngstown State University's College of Arts and Sciences, has been chosen to deliver the address at the university's annual Honor's Convocation. Dr. Ronda's speech will be entitled "In Search of the University: Lost and Found." The program, which recognizes students for academic achievement and also designates distinguished professors will be held in the Chestnut Room of Kilcawley Center, May 14. Youngstown State University's Annual Awards Night, to honor students, student organizations and advisors, will be held May 16 in the Chestnut Room of Kilcawley Center. en_US
